OsteoCentric Technologies, founded in 2015, is a medical technology company operating in orthopedics and dental sectors. The company develops and leverages its proprietary Unifi Mechanical Integration (UnifiMI) technology, which mechanically integrates with bone to provide instant, multi-axial stability and load sharing in both normal and compromised bone. OsteoCentric collaborates with design surgeons to advance implant performance and expand the application of UnifiMI technology across its target medical disciplines.
